describe the regional variation in the climatic condition of India with the help of suitable examples❓in 8 lines

Answer»

In India many regional variations in CLIMATIC conditions are found due to its vast size. But due to the influence of monsoons India has a broad Unity .

Many factors like location , altitude , distance from the Sea, general relief produce regional variation in pattern of winds, temperature and rainfall.

The example given below illustrate the climatic differences:

i) Temperature:

Barmer( Rajasthan) has recorded the highest the temperature 50° C in summer and 15° C at night while hilly region like Gulmarg( Kashmir) have a day temperature of 20°C in June.

The winter temperatures at Dras & Kargil (Leh)
drops as low as - 45°C on the other hand Chennai may record only 20°C in December.

The annual range of temperature is about 12°C at Cochin while it is about 40°C in Punjab. Coastal regions have almost uniform temperature throughout the year.


ii) Rainfall:

The striking differences are found in rainfall pattern. Mawsynram (Meghalaya) annual rainfall of 1140 CM is the rainiest place in the world while Jaisalmer( Rajasthan) rarely gets more than 12 centimetre of annual rainfall and Leh gets only 10 cm rainfall.

The Western Coastal plain gets rain Storms while the Coromandel coast remains dry. when the Brahmaputra valley is submerged in floods it brings drought in Bihar


iii) Monsoons:

The dates of onset and withdrawal of monsoon differ in various parts. The West Coast get monsoon in the first WEEK of June while interior parts like Punjab the monsoon by the first week of July.


iv) Seasons:

The southern PART of the country have uniformly high temperature throughout the year. There is no winter SEASON in the south. on the other hand seasonal extremes are found in the north. In Summer Heat wave is produced called LOO where as a cold wave is felt in winter.

Explain the process of manufacturing of Steel

Answer»

Steelmaking is the process for producing steel from iron ore and scrap. In steelmaking, impurities such as nitrogen, silicon, PHOSPHORUS, sulfur and excess CARBON are removed from the raw iron, and alloying elements such as manganese, nickel, chromium and vanadium are added to produce different GRADES of steel. Limiting dissolved gases such as nitrogen and oxygen, and entrained impurities (termed "inclusions") in the steel is also important to ensure the quality of the products cast from the liquid steel.[1]

Steelmaking has existed for millennia, but it was not commercialized on a massive scale until the 19th century. The ancient craft process of steelmaking was the crucible process. In the 1850s and 1860s, the BESSEMER process and the Siemens-Martin process turned steelmaking into a heavy industry. Today there are two major commercial processes for making steel, namely basic oxygen steelmaking, which has liquid pig-iron from the blast furnace and scrap steel as the main feed materials, and electric arc furnace (EAF) steelmaking, which uses scrap steel or direct reduced iron (DRI) as the main feed materials. Oxygen steelmaking is fuelled PREDOMINANTLY by the exothermic nature of the reactions inside the vessel where as in EAF steelmaking, electrical energy is used to melt the solid scrap and/or DRI materials. In recent times, EAF steelmaking technology has evolved closer to oxygen steelmaking as more chemical energy is introduced into the process.[2]

What are the steps taken by NTPC to control environmental degradation

Answer»

Steps taken by NTPC

1. Optimum utilization of equipment by using latest technologies and upgrading the existing ones. 

2. Waste generation has been minimized by MAXIMUM utilization of ash.

 3. Green belts have been provided for ecological balance and afforestation through special purpose vehicles.

 4. ENVIRONMENTAL pollution has been reduced by measures like ash pond management, ash water recycling and liquid waste management. 

5. All the power stations have ecological MONITORING, reviews and online databases.

The Ganges basin is a part of the Ganges-BRAHMAPUTRA basin draining 1,086,000 square kilometres in Tibet, Nepal, India and Bangladesh. To the north, the Himalaya or lower parallel ranges beyond form the Ganges-Brahmaputra divide. On the west the Ganges Basin BORDERS the Indus basin and then the Aravalli ridge. Southern limits are the Vindhyas and CHOTA Nagpur Plateau. On the east the Ganges merges with the Brahmaputra through a complex system of common distributaries into the Bay of Bengal. Its catchment lies in the STATES of Uttar Pradesh (294,364 km²), Madhya Pradesh(198,962 km²), Bihar (143,961 km²), Rajasthan(112,490 km²), West Bengal (71,485 km²), Haryana (34,341 km²), Himachal Pradesh(4,317 km²) , Delhi, Arunachal pradesh(1,484 km²), the whole of Bangladesh, Nepal and Bhutan. Several tributaries RISE inside Tibet before flowing south through Nepal. The basin has a population of more than 500 million, making it the most populated river basin in the world.

Bharat mein suti vastra Udyog ke Vikas or Vitran ka varnan kare

Answer»

सूती वस्त्र उद्योग भारत का सबसे प्रभावशाली उद्योग है. इस उद्योग से भारत के करोडो लोगो को रोज़गार मिला हुआ है. भारत के हर राज्य में प्राय छोटी बड़ी सूती वस्त्र की मिले है ।

भारत में पहली सूती मिल की फैक्ट्री 1854 में मुंबई में खोली गयी थी। 1856 में इसमें उत्पादन आरम्भ हो गया  था । इसके पहले भी 1818 में कोलकाता तथा 1851 में  मुंबई  में सूती वस्त्र उद्योग के कारखाने खोले गए पर वे असफल रहे । 1856 के बाद सूती वस्त्र उद्योग का बड़े पैमाने पर विकास देखा गया तथा आजकल के सूती मिलो में कतई के साथ साथ वस्त्र निर्माण भी होता है ।  

भारत में सूती वस्त्र उद्योग का वितरण बड़े पैमाने पर गुजरात तथा महाराष्ट्र में पाया जाता है । इसके अलावा भी तमिलनाडु, केरल , कर्नाटक, पश्चिम बंगाल, उत्तर प्रदेश, मध्य प्रदेश तथा आंध्र प्रदेश में भी इसका उत्पादन होता है.देश के कुल सूती उत्पादन का 70% अकेले महाराष्ट्र तथा गुजरात से होता  है ।

Mining poses significant and potentially UNDERESTIMATED risks to tropical forests worldwide. In Brazil’s Amazon, mining drives deforestation FAR beyond operational lease boundaries, yet the full extent of these IMPACTS is unknown and thus neglected in environmental licensing. Here we quantify mining-induced deforestation and investigate the aspects of mining operations, which most likely contribute. We find mining significantly increased Amazon forest loss up to 70 km beyond mining lease boundaries, causing 11,670 km2 of deforestation between 2005 and 2015. This extent represents 9% of all Amazon forest loss during this TIME and 12 times more deforestation than occurred within mining leases alone. Pathways leading to such impacts include mining infrastructure establishment, urban EXPANSION to support a growing workforce, and development of mineral commodity supply chains. Mining-induced deforestation is not unique to Brazil; to mitigate adverse impacts of mining and conserve tropical forests globally, environmental assessments and licensing must considered both on- and off-lease sources of deforestation.

What is the height of mount Everest

Answer»

Mount Everest, known in Nepali as Sagarmatha and in Tibetan as CHOMOLUNGMA, is Earth's highest MOUNTAIN above sea level, located in the Mahalangur Himal sub-range of the Himalayas. The international border between Nepal and CHINA RUNS across its summit point.

Elevation: 8,848 m

First ASCENT: 29 May 1953

Prominence: 8,848 m

First ascenders: Edmund Hillary, Tenzing Norgay

Mountain range: Himalayas, Mahalangur Himal
